Transaction 23c632bd517ca94fa85b93f92bc97c50ee9004364ee67dc73812eed90e75bd75

1 Input
2 Outputs
  • 23c632bd517ca94fa85b93f92bc97c50ee9004364ee67dc73812eed90e75bd75:0
  • value  275441
    address  1Dun6Wic7AyxpaF4dS8KL86SHZxVRCXr7d
  • 23c632bd517ca94fa85b93f92bc97c50ee9004364ee67dc73812eed90e75bd75:1
  • value  27200357
    address  bc1qdeff7ucdan37rf846x7hrg05z9y6aka8xa3ltvp90zjr5zcy0k3sk8wfqm